The AprilAire E070W is a powerful crawl space dehumidifier that removes up to 70 pints of moisture daily, making it suitable for spaces up to 2,200 square feet like basements and crawl spaces. Its capacity is well matched for larger or whole-house applications, helping prevent mold, odors, and wood damage effectively. The built-in Wi-Fi connectivity is a standout feature, allowing you to monitor and adjust humidity levels remotely via an app, which adds convenience especially for busy households or second homes.
It comes with a quiet condensate pump, which is helpful if gravity drainage isn't possible, and includes all installation accessories like a hanging kit and MERV 11 filter. This makes setup easier without extra trips to the hardware store. The unit’s automatic features, such as moisture control, defrost, and shutoff, help maintain optimal performance without constant attention.
The unit is relatively heavy (56 pounds) and its size (12.5" x 25" x 12.5") might limit portability or placement flexibility in very tight crawl spaces. Energy use at 696 watts is moderate but not the most efficient available, so electricity costs could add up if run continuously. The inclusion of a quiet pump suggests moderate sound that may be noticeable in very quiet areas.
This dehumidifier is a solid choice for those needing strong moisture control over a large area with smart features and convenient installation options. It suits homeowners looking to protect their crawl spaces or basements while enjoying remote control capabilities, though it may be less ideal for small, cramped spaces or those highly concerned about energy consumption.

The ALORAIR Wi-Fi Crawl Space Dehumidifier is a powerful unit designed for large crawl spaces and basements, capable of removing up to 90 pints of moisture daily under normal conditions, with a maximum capacity of 198 pints in saturated environments. It covers an area up to 2600 square feet, making it suitable for sizable spaces that need consistent humidity control. A standout feature is its smart Wi-Fi connectivity, which allows you to monitor and adjust settings remotely through an app—convenient for keeping an eye on humidity levels without frequent visits.
This model includes an automatic defrost system, ensuring it works efficiently even in cooler temperatures without frost buildup interrupting its operation. The built-in continuous drainage option with a hose simplifies water removal, reducing maintenance hassle. It also has a MERV-1 filter to improve air quality. The unit is fairly heavy at over 70 pounds and not very compact, so moving it around might be difficult. Energy-wise, it uses about 639 watts, which is typical for a unit of this capacity but means some ongoing electricity cost to keep it running.
Backed by a solid 5-year warranty and safety certifications, this dehumidifier is a reliable choice for those needing a heavy-duty, tech-friendly solution for large, damp spaces. It is ideal for homeowners or professionals managing moisture in large crawl spaces or commercial settings who value remote control and efficient moisture removal.

The AprilAire E080 Pro is a solid choice for anyone looking to manage humidity in crawl spaces, basements, or even whole homes. With an impressive capacity of 80 pints per day, it can effectively handle spaces up to 4,400 square feet, making it a strong contender for larger areas. One of its major strengths is its energy efficiency, being Energy Star certified, which not only helps lower energy bills but also benefits the environment. Users will appreciate the smart sensing technology that automatically activates dehumidification when humidity exceeds the set target, allowing for a 'set and forget' approach.
The drainage options are convenient, as it eliminates the need for manual emptying by allowing continuous drainage through a hose or floor drain. This feature is especially beneficial in maintaining low humidity levels without extra hassle.
However, potential buyers should note that it is somewhat bulky, weighing 63 pounds and measuring 14 x 26 x 15 inches. While it is designed for durability with corrosion-resistant coils, its size may present portability challenges, especially for those who might want to move it around. Additionally, it operates with a single-speed setting, which could be limiting for users looking for customizable airflow options. The digital display and built-in humidistat add to its functionality, though the setup process may be complex for some based on their experience level with home appliances. The AprilAire E080 Pro excels in capacity, efficiency, and automated features, making it an excellent choice for larger living spaces, though its size and setup may require consideration.
